Cuando acaba la noche (1950)

shadowy streetsdesperate loyaltiesold-school sleuthing

Overview

DramaCrime

Newspaper reporter interests himself in contesting a manslaughter verdict on behalf of the son of a woman who saves his life.

Deep Dive

Trivia, insights & behind the scenes

Cultural

This is Golden Age Mexican cinema's answer to American noir—Gómez Muriel studied under Sergei Eisenstein during his 1930s Mexico sojourn.

Trivia

Lilia Prado was Mexico's biggest star; this role let her play against type as a suffering mother rather than the glamorous leads she was known for.
